    Veteran \Vet"er*an\, a. [L. veteranus, from vetus, veteris, old;
    akin to Gr. ? year, Skr. vatsara. See {Wether}.]
    Long exercised in anything, especially in military life and
    the duties of a soldier; long practiced or experienced; as, a
    veteran officer or soldier; veteran skill.

    The insinuating eloquence and delicate flattery of
    veteran diplomatists and courtiers. --Macaulay.


    Veteran \Vet"er*an\, n. [L. veteranus (sc. miles): cf. F.
    v['e]t['e]ran.]
    One who has been long exercised in any service or art,
    particularly in war; one who has had.

    Ensigns that pierced the foe's remotest lines,
    The hardy veteran with tears resigns. --Addison.

    Note: In the United States, during the civil war, soldiers
    who had served through one term of enlistment and had
    re["e]nlisted were specifically designated veterans.
